Balzac and The Little Chinese Seamstress

synopsis


Based on writer-director Dai Sijie's bestselling autobiographical novel of the same name, Balzac and the Little Chinese Seamstress is a beguiling love story set during the 1970's Cultural Revolution. Luo (Chen Kun) and Ma (Liu Ye), two bourgeois young men from the city are sent to a remote, culturally barren mountain village for re-education in Maoist principles. Discovering a hidden cache of books by western writers such as Flaubert, Dumas and Balzac, the pair transmit thier love of art and literature to the knowledge hungry local seamstress (Xun Zhou), with whom they both prompty fall in love. Balzac and the Little Chinese Seamstress is an evocative and luminously shot paean to a time long past and to the realisation that change can bring freedom.
